* [[Distracted by the Sexy]]: Sativa, upon meeting Sean. And every few pages afterwards.
{{quote|A slow voice, like a tawny port, breathed, "Who is ''That?''" into my left ear. "He's ''Pretty!''" Sativa always talked like that.}}
* [[Fantastic Drug]]: The Reality Pill. Other than its "[[Reality Warper]]-in-a-pill" effects, it seems to be little more than a mild euphoric/hallucingenic.
* [[Glass-Shattering Sound]]: During the climactic battle, Chester briefly notes one of the others defeating a crystalline alien by singing at it until it shatters.
* [[Gondor Calls for Aid]]: The last-minute rush to assemble a vanful of hippies to fight the Lobsters before they can dose the reservoir with liquid Reality Pill.

* [[The Judge]]: THE Judge. He spontaneously appears (along with a court room) when someone mentions a trial for the Lobsters after they've been defeated. Although the heroes aren't entirely sure he's ''real'', Ktch and the Lobsters take him and the sentence he pronounces ''very'' seriously.
* [[Lust Object]]: Sean, for Sativa. They fall into both bed and a serious relationship with each other within a couple hours of their first meeting, so it's probably mutual.
* [[Made on Drugs]]: [[In-Universe]] example -- anything manifested under the influence of the Reality Pill, of course.
* [[Meaningful Name]]: [[wikipedia:Cannabis sativa|Sativa]] and the Tripouts.
* [[Mind Control]]: Deliciously played with. Even as he's being interrogated by Ktch with a psychotronic "torture machine", Chester discovers that he can control him and the other Lobsters by focusing on a song, "Love Sold in Doses", that his band performs. As a result, he learns ''far'' more about the Lobsters' plans than they learn about his.
